David J. Toms has authored 106 papers that have received a total of 2.5k indexed citations.
This includes 78 papers in Nuclear and High Energy Physics, 69 papers in Astronomy and Astrophysics and 58 papers in Atomic and Molecular Physics, and Optics. The topics of these papers are Black Holes and Theoretical Physics (75 papers), Cosmology and Gravitation Theories (68 papers) and Quantum Electrodynamics and Casimir Effect (36 papers). David J. Toms is often cited by papers focused on Black Holes and Theoretical Physics (75 papers), Cosmology and Gravitation Theories (68 papers) and Quantum Electrodynamics and Casimir Effect (36 papers) and collaborates with scholars based in United Kingdom, United States and Canada. David J. Toms's co-authors include Klaus Kirsten, Leonard Parker, Antonino Flachi, G. Kunstatter and Ian G. Moss and has published in prestigious journals such as Nature, Physical Review Letters and Nuclear Physics B.
